Oceaneering Space Systems Division specializes in the turnkey design, development, manufacturing, certification, maintenance, testing, and sustaining engineering of equipment used inside and outside spacecraft, robotic systems, and thermal protection systems for expendable and reusable space vehicles. We provide engineering and support services, such as for astronaut training in NASA’s Neutral Buoyancy Laboratory near the Johnson Space Center in Houston, Texas. Oceaneering works with Made In Space on its Archinaut project, and with Alpha Space on electromechanical systems for its Materials on International Space Station Experiment facility. Oceaneering holds AS9100C/ISO 9001:2008 certification for aerospace quality management system standards. www.oceaneering.com

Spaceport America is an FAA-licensed spaceport located on 18,000 acres of State Trust Land in the Jornada del Muerto desert basin in New Mexico, United States directly west and adjacent to U.S. Army's White Sands Missile Range. www.spaceportamerica.com
